Free shipping for many products! WebThe Great Glen Way is divided into 6 stages and is 79 mile/127 km long. The traditional way of walking this route is starting in Fort William and making your way northeast to Inverness. You can do the trek in 6 days or, if you want a more challenging trek, you can combine some of the stages to make a shorter itinerary.

Bing maps has a collection of great trails … WebThe Great Glen (An Gleann Mor) follows 80 miles of lochs and rivers from Glencoe and Fort William in the south to Inverness in the north. It's a fantastic natural route through the Scottish Highlands, with exceptional scenery and gorgeous forests. You can walk, cycle and canoe the Great Glen Way, or drive along the A82 and explore dozens of ...
